About this program

The Bachelor of Science in Health Sciences at Fisher College equips students with a comprehensive understanding of the health care system, emphasizing the importance of preventive care and wellness. The program covers various aspects of health, including public health, health policy, and the biological sciences, providing a well-rounded foundation for students interested in the health sector. Students will delve into subjects such as health promotion, disease prevention, and health communication, ensuring they are prepared to tackle real-world health challenges.

Throughout the program, students engage in a mix of lectures, hands-on learning opportunities, and collaborative projects that promote critical thinking and problem-solving skills. The curriculum is designed to adapt to the ever-evolving health landscape, integrating contemporary health issues and practices. Faculty members are industry professionals who bring valuable insights and experiences into the classroom.

By completing this program, students will develop essential skills in research methodologies, data analysis, and effective communication, which are crucial in the health sciences field. Furthermore, the interdisciplinary approach of the program prepares graduates to work alongside various health professionals and organizations, enhancing their employability in a competitive job market.

Studying in the US offers a unique advantage, as it provides exposure to an advanced health care system, innovative practices, and diverse perspectives within the health sciences. Fisher College's commitment to fostering a supportive learning environment ensures that students not only gain knowledge but also build a professional network that can aid in their future careers.

Entry requirements

To enroll in the Bachelor of Science in Health Sciences program, prospective students are typically required to have a high school diploma or equivalent. Strong academic performance in subjects like biology, chemistry, and mathematics is highly recommended to prepare for the coursework ahead. Additionally, students may need to submit letters of recommendation and a personal statement outlining their interest in health sciences.

English:

International students whose first language is not English must demonstrate proficiency in the language through standardized tests. Typically, a minimum TOEFL score of 80 or an IELTS score of 6.5 is expected. Alternative assessments may also be considered, and students are encouraged to verify the latest requirements directly with the institution.

International students:

International students must adhere to U.S. immigration regulations to study at Fisher College. This includes obtaining an F-1 student visa, which requires the issuance of an I-20 form from the college. Students should also familiarize themselves with SEVIS (Student and Exchange Visitor Information System) requirements for maintaining their visa status while studying in the United States.
